Prep Time: 0 Minutes Cook Time: 60 Minutes |
Ready In: 60 Minutes Servings: 8 |
|
I've come across many variations on this classic side dish - most I've disliked quite a lot. Not this one though - this one is a keeper for me. Ingredients:
3 eggs |
1 stick butter, melted |
1 box jiffy cornbread mix |
1/4 cup grated onion |
4 oz whipped cream cheese |
1/2 teaspoon salt |
1/2 teaspoon pepper |
1 can creamed corn |
1 can kernel corn (drained) |
1 cup cheddar cheese |
Directions:
1. In a bowl, beat the eggs, melted butter, cornbread mix, grated onion, whipped cream cheese, salt and pepper until combined. 2. Stir in the corn and cheddar cheese. 3. Pour into a greased 11x7 baking dish. 4. Bake uncovered in a 350 oven for 45-55 minutes, until the edges are browned and pull away from the sides of the dish. |
